armchair
//ˈɑːmˌtʃeə(r)//
Noun
armchairSingular
armchairsPlural
1
A comfortable chair with side supports for a person's arms.
She sat in the armchair by the window and read a book.
Synonym
Adjective
armchairCanonical form
1
Lacking practical experience or direct involvement; theoretical rather than hands-on.
He's just an armchair critic who has never actually made a film.
